Ingredients

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il 1 shallot, minced 8 ounces portobello mushrooms, caps cleaned, halved, and thinly sliced 3/4 pound trimmed green beans Coarse salt and ground pepper

Directions

Heat oil in a 10-inch nonstick skillet over medium heat. Add shallot; cook, stirring, until translucent, 3 to 5 minutes. Add mushroom caps; cook until tender, 8 to 10 minutes.

Add 3/4 cup water and green beans; season with salt and pepper. Stir to combine; reduce heat to low. Cover; cook until beans are crisp-tender, 7 to 10 minutes. If any liquid remains, raise heat, and cook until it evaporates.
